Creativity isn’t random. It’s a system.
The Spark Method by Grant E. Wuellner is a structured approach to creativity built through years of work in storytelling, performance, and creative process.
At its core, the method includes over 100 structured prompts organized into practical toolkits designed to help you move forward with clarity, rhythm, and confidence.
In this free 30-minute interactive workshop, you’ll experience how this structured system works across three areas:
• Storytelling and idea development
• Business and problem-solving
• Everyday creative thinking
Through guided participation and a live audience brainstorm, you’ll see how simple, structured Sparks bring direction and steady forward motion to your ideas.
This session offers a first look into a growing Spark Method ecosystem that includes guided tools and future workshops.
Whether you're a writer, storyteller, educator, business professional, student, or simply someone with ideas you want to develop, this experience is designed to give you practical tools you can return to again and again.
